41 Acre* Blank Canvas!

Middlesex, a sought after locality approximately 12km from the 'food bowl capital' of Manjimup. This 41 acre* property has sweeping views of the Middlesex corridor. The block is supported with a dam and a 4 kilowatt solar system.
The owners currently have their beef stock grazing the property. There is a battle-axe entry to the property from Pipe Clay Gully Road.

Manjimup Shire is committed to building on the region's momentum as the food bowl of WA with initiatives such as the Southern Forests Food Council, and goals of expanding markets for fresh produce, both nationally and internationally.

There are many tourist attractions in the Manjimup area including the Manjimup Heritage Park, Diamond Tree, walking and biking trails and national parks.
